1. 首页 > 游戏攻略

极限竞速生态系统分析 8月技术分析 Nintendo Switch开发教程

作者:admin 更新时间:2026-01-12
摘要:当赛车文化遇上移动平台在手游市场同质化严重的今天,《极限竞速》系列凭借其硬核的物理引擎和沉浸式赛车体验,始终占据着移动端竞速游戏的头部位置,2023年8月,"/>

当赛车文化遇上移动平台

在手游市场同质化严重的今天,《极限竞速》系列凭借其硬核的物理引擎和沉浸式赛车体验,始终占据着移动端竞速游戏的头部位置, 2024年8月,随着新版本更新和跨平台生态的进一步整合,这款游戏再次成为玩家热议的焦点,Nintendo Switch平台凭借其 特殊的便携性与主机性能平衡,吸引了大量独立开发者尝试移植或开发竞速类游戏, 这篇文章小编将将从《极限竞速》的生态 体系构建、8月技术更新亮点,以及Switch平台开发实战三个维度展开分析,为从业者和 爱慕者提供有 价格的参考。


《极限竞速》生态 体系分析:从单机到社交的闭环构建

核心玩法与用户分层

《极限竞速》的成功首先源于其对赛车玩家的精准分层:

  • 硬核玩家:追求拟真物理(如轮胎抓地力、空气动力学模拟)、车辆改装深度(从引擎调校到悬挂几何)和线上联赛竞技性。
  • 休闲玩家:通过“辅助驾驶模式”降低操作门槛,搭配风景优美的开放 全球赛道(如新增的“阿尔卑斯山雪景赛道”)和剧情任务吸引泛用户。
  • 社交玩家:依托“车队 体系”和“实时观战功能”,构建UGC内容生态(如玩家自定义涂装、赛道设计分享)。

跨平台数据互通与商业化模型

8月更新中,游戏首次实现iOS/Android/PC/Xbox全平台数据互通,玩家可通过微软账号同步车辆收藏、改装方案和赛季进度,这种设计不仅提升了用户留存率,还通过“跨平台赛季通行证”实现了商业化闭环——玩家在任何平台消费均可解锁全平台奖励,直接拉动付费率提升17%(据Sensor Tower数据)。

秀丽坏女人

社区运营与长线生态

官方通过“每周挑战赛”和“玩家创意工坊”持续输出内容:

  • 挑战赛:结合现实赛事热点(如F1比利时站)设计限时任务,奖励限定车辆皮肤。
  • 创意工坊:玩家上传的赛道设计经审核后可加入官方“社区精选赛”,创作者获得分成收益,这种模式既降低了内容生产成本,又增强了用户粘性。

8月技术分析:移动端竞速游戏的性能突破

图形渲染优化:HDR与动态分辨率

针对中低端定位器性能限制,8月更新引入了动态分辨率渲染(DRS)技术:

  • 在复杂场景(如夜间城市赛道)中, 体系自动降低分辨率至720p以保证帧率稳定,同时通过HDR色调映射保持视觉效果。
  • 测试数据显示,搭载骁龙665芯片的设备在开启DRS后,平均帧率从32fps提升至48fps,卡顿率下降63%。

物理引擎升级:从“拟真”到“可玩”的平衡

弱水锆势耳机 此前版本因物理过于硬核导致休闲玩家流失,此次更新通过分层物理模型解决这一 难题:

  • 高 质量模式:完整模拟车辆重心转移、轮胎形变等细节,供专业玩家使用。
  • 简化模式:将物理计算抽象为“抓地力系数”和“转向响应曲线”,降低操作门槛。
  • 开发者透露,该技术灵感源自《极限竞速:地平线》的Switch版适配经验。

网络同步与反作弊

《脑机接口》科技纪录片 针对跨平台联机,游戏采用“预测+校正”同步机制:

  • 客户端预先模拟其他玩家动作,服务器每100ms校正一次位置数据,将延迟影响降至最低。
  • 反作弊 体系新增“设备指纹识别”功能,可检测模拟器、外挂脚本等异常行为,封禁率提升22%。

Nintendo Switch开发教程:从零打造竞速游戏原型

开发环境搭建

  • 工具链:Unity 2024 LTS + SwitchWorks插件(需申请Nintendo开发者账号)。
  • 性能基准:Switch的NVIDIA Tegra X1芯片性能接近骁龙835,建议目标帧率30fps,分辨率720p(掌机模式)/1080p(主机模式)。

核心功能实现

(1)车辆控制基础

// 简化版车辆物理脚本(Unity C) public class CarController : MonoBehaviour { public float xSpeed = 100f; public float acceleration = 10f; public float turnSpeed = 5f; private Rigidbody rb; void Start() { rb = GetComponent<Rigidbody>(); } void FixedUpdate() { float moveInput = Input.GetAxis("Vertical"); // 加速/刹车 float turnInput = Input.GetAxis("Horizontal"); // 转向 // 加速控制 if (rb.velocity. gnitude < xSpeed) { rb.AddForce(transform.forward * acceleration * moveInput); } // 转向控制(根据速度衰减) float effectiveTurnSpeed = turnSpeed * (1 - rb.velocity. gnitude / xSpeed); transform.Rotate(Vector3.up * turnInput * effectiveTurnSpeed); } }

(2)赛道碰撞检测优化

  • 使用复合碰撞体:将赛道拆分为多个简单形状(Box/Capsule Collider),比单一Mesh Collider性能提升40%。
  • LOD分组:根据距离动态加载不同精度的碰撞体,远距离赛道使用简化模型。

Switch专属优化技巧

  • 内存管理:避免动态内存分配,使用对象池(Object Pooling)复用车辆、特效等资源。
  • GPU压力测试:通过Nintendo的“DevMenu”工具监控帧 时刻,确保单帧渲染不超过16.6ms。
  • 触屏适配:为掌机模式设计虚拟摇杆+按钮布局,支持HD震动反馈(如碰撞时触发短促震动)。

发布前检查清单

  • 分辨率适配:确认UI在720p/1080p下均清晰可读。
  • 性能测试:使用Switch模拟器运行30分钟,检查内存泄漏和过热 难题。
  • 合规性:确保游戏内容符合Nintendo的ESRB评级标准(如无血腥、暴力元素)。

移动竞速游戏的未来 路线

《极限竞速》的生态 体系证明,硬核与休闲并非对立面——通过技术分层和社区运营,一款游戏可以同时满足不同用户需求,而对于Switch开发者而言,抓住“便携性+ 特殊交互”这一核心优势,或许能在红海市场中找到突破口,无论是移植经典IP还是开发原创作品,对性能的 极点优化和对玩家体验的深度 领会,始终是成功的关键。